Prioritizing Renovations

  1. Kitchens and Bathrooms: These rooms are often the focal points for potential buyers. Modernizing kitchens with energy-efficient appliances, updated countertops, and functional cabinetry can significantly increase a home’s appeal. Similarly, bathroom upgrades like walk-in showers and updated fixtures can be compelling selling points.
  2. Energy Efficiency: With a growing emphasis on sustainability, energy-efficient upgrades can be a major draw. This includes installing high-efficiency windows, improving insulation, and incorporating smart home technology for energy management.
  3. Creating Additional Living Space: Converting basements or attics into functional living spaces can substantially increase a home’s usable square footage, thus enhancing its value. These areas can be transformed into home offices, extra bedrooms, or entertainment spaces, catering to the increasing demand for versatile home environments.
  4. Curb Appeal: First impressions matter. Investing in landscaping, a fresh coat of paint, and ensuring a well-maintained exterior can greatly improve a property’s curb appeal and, consequently, its market value.
  5. Adapting to Current Trends: Keeping an eye on current design trends can be beneficial. However, it’s important to balance trendiness with timelessness to ensure the property appeals to a broader audience.

Budget Considerations

Balancing the cost of renovations with the potential return on investment is crucial. Over-renovating can lead to losses, as the cost may not always be recouped through the sale price. Homeowners should consult real estate professionals to gauge the most profitable renovations for their specific market and property.

Hiring Professionals

While DIY projects can save money, hiring professionals for more complex renovations ensures quality work that meets local building codes and standards. This can also avoid costly mistakes and delays.
